A bar graph is a chart used to represent data with rectangular bars. The length or height of each bar corresponds to the value it represents. Bar graphs help compare different categories of data and are commonly used to show trends or distributions in an easy-to-understand visual format.

In this chapter students learn how to collect organize and present data. They explore methods like tally marks tables and bar graphs to represent information. The chapter also focuses on interpreting the data and drawing conclusions. These skills are essential for understanding and communicating data clearly.

  1. A bar graph represents data using bars of uniform width. The length or height of each bar corresponds to the value it represents, making it easy to compare different categories.
